Nginx教程

Linux_04 nginx服务安装

本文主要是介绍Linux_04 nginx服务安装,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

目录
  • nginx服务安装

nginx服务安装

在linux下安装nginx,首先需要安装gcc-c++编译器,然后安装nginx依赖的pcre和zlib包

//1、安装gcc-c++编译器
yum install gcc-c++  
yum install -y openssl openssl-devel

//2、安装pcre和zlib包,加-y是所有询问全部yes
yum install -y pcre pcre-devel  
yum install -y zlib zlib-devel

//3、创建nginx文件夹
mkdir /usr/local/nginx

//4、下载nginx(没有安装wget的请安装,安装命令:yum -y install wget),也可以下载后上传
wget http://nginx.org/download/nginx-1.9.9.tar.gz

//5、解压并进入nginx目录
tar -zxvf nginx-1.9.9.tar.gz
cd nginx-1.9.9

//6、使用nginx默认配置,编译安装 
//7、错误提示:./configure报-bash: ./configure: No such file or directory 查找:find -name configure
./configure    //find -name configure
make
make install

//8、在网站输入ip加默认80端口出现welcome to nginx即安装成功
whereis nginx     //查找nginx安装路径
./nginx           //进入sbin目录执行,或者 /usr/local/nginx/sbin/./nginx
ps -ef|grep nginx //查看是否启动成功:nginx:master process ./nginx

//9、nginx -s quit         优雅停止nginx,有连接时会等连接请求完成再杀死worker进程  nginx -s reload     优雅重启,并重新载入配置文件nginx.confnginx -s reopen     重新打开日志文件,一般用于切割日志
nginx -t          //查看配置文件是否正确:/usr/nginx/sbin/nginx -t
nginx -s stop nginx //停止服务
nginx -s reload   //重新加载配置文件:/usr/local/nginx/sbin/nginx -s reload

nginx -s reload|reopen|stop|quit  //重新加载配置文件|重启|停止|退出

chkconfig nginx on  //设置开机启动

nginx -V //查看nginx模块,配置文件在哪,启动目录在哪
这篇关于Linux_04 nginx服务安装的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!